> Things that come to mind and are worth checking:

> - folder compression, especially for the Inbox and Outbox.

I've run the compleate maintenence on all folders in all accounts - it
only recovered some disc space, but did nothing to the CPU problems.

> - plugin use, especially antispam have been reportedly culpable for
> problems as you're experiencing.

I tried to remove my only plugin BayersIt, and it didn't help either.
I also tried to disable my Norton Antivirus.

> - a mailbase that is problematic will have TB! spending an
> inordinately long time with it.

It happens in all folders, in all of my 4 accounts. One have only
handled less than 100 mails.

> - check your temp folder for overload. TB! uses the temp folder when
> downloading messages and an overloaded temp folder will slow it down.

Empty - didn't help.

I think it is a regular bug, and not just the usual errors in the
mailbox files.
The problem has existed from I ran 2.11 the first time, and I have
never had any problems with 2.x. It would be too much of a coincidence
if 4 mailboxes should be damaged at the exact same time as I upgraded.
As far as I know the installation does not alter the mailbox files, and
no one else have had this problem
